Default Surface Prep Questions

Does any suggestions for the pads and material that would be needed to get swirl marks out of my white C5?

I currently have Zaino fusion as a polisher but i'm sure its going to be too weak of a cut. I just bought a 7 in rotory buffer so whatever works with that size will work.

After the surface is prepped I'll be doing...

2 Coats of Z2 + ZFX
2 Coats Z-CS

How severe are your defects?

Edge yellow wool with presta 1500 polish for moderate defects.

Edge yellow wool with 3M extra cut compound for deeper defects.

Menzerna SIP is good but IMO a PITA to work with. It was actually made to work on the final assembly line in a controlled environment.

Finishing polishes: You should be able to clean up any "wool mess" with ZPC and a white LC CCS pad.

Menzerna 106ff- very nice but can at times also be a PITA, not as bad as SIP IMO. LC CCS white pad

3M ultra fina- My favorite finishing polish. Get it with the 3M blue 8" foam polishing pad. Never a hologram left on the rotary. Even on soft black clears.

Menzerna FPII- works very nice. LC CCS white pad.

If not using ZPC for a finishing polish, then you should do a 50/50 IPA/water, Z6 or just rewash the car to get the proper surface for Zaino to bond to.

I have gone right over ZPC with NO problems at all. Maybe a Z6 wipe if there is a lot of polishing dust but ZPC contains no oils so it wil not hinder Zaino bonding.

I have also been able to remove a significant anount of defects with just ZPC and the proper pads on my rotary. For instance if you have a purple foamed wool pad and use it with ZPC at speeds of 900 to 1200 it will remove some pretty significant moderate swirling and then just follow up with a white pad/ZPC and then apply your Zaino.
